SAP MB21、MB1A、MBST、MB22 中的库存预留

SAP 中的库存预留

预留是系统文档,显示了生产、成本中心和任何其他需求的特定数量的物料。

预留对于计划/MRP/ATP 很重要,因为系统会在过账前预留所需数量。如果系统中没有预留,我们可能会遇到一个问题:我们需要为生产订单使用物料,但由于销售订单在几分钟前已占用这些物料,我们无法过账物料发出。当我们创建预留时,系统不允许任何其他凭证为其他目的预留物料。这还取决于 MRP/ATP 的系统设置。您可能可以为预留提供始终从库存中提取物料的权限,即使它已被销售订单或交货预留(这不是一个好方法)。但您也可以自定义系统,使销售订单在执行可用性检查时不对预留进行检查。

您可以出于多种原因创建物料预留。如果 MRP 设置暗示了这种系统行为,系统也可以创建预留。

这可以通过系统自动完成,或者通过使用 **MB21** 事务代码来完成。

使用 MB21 预留库存

步骤 1)

  1. 执行 MB21 事务。
  2. 根据需要填写字段。

Reservation of Inventory in SAP MB21

可以为消耗(移动类型 201)、生产订单(移动类型 261)、库存转移(311)、销售订单、项目、网络等创建物料预留。

根据您的需求选择合适的移动类型。选择移动类型 **201**。

如果您输入了移动类型 **321**(从上面的屏幕),您肯定会收到错误消息。这意味着此移动类型不能用于创建预留。

这也意味着您没有仔细按照我的步骤进行。请阅读上面的文字,其中说明我们将使用移动类型 **201**。

步骤 2)

  1. 输入成本中心。
  2. 填写项目数据。物料号、数量、来源库位。

Reservation of Inventory in SAP MB21

保存凭证。您将获得在下一步中使用的预留编号。

Reservation of Inventory in SAP MB21

现在我们必须为预留创建物料凭证。我们可以通过 MIGO 来完成,但这次让我们学习另一个事务。

使用 MB1A 预留库存

我们可以使用事务代码 **MB1A** 来创建参照物料预留的货物发出。

步骤 1)

  1. 执行事务。
  2. 选择 **“参照预留...”** 按钮。

Reservation of Inventory by using MB1A

步骤 2)

  1. 输入预留编号。
  2. 确认。

Reservation of Inventory by using MB1A

步骤 3)

  1. 如果您需要更改任何字段、数量、库位等,请进行更改并保存凭证。

Reservation of Inventory by using MB1A

您将在状态栏消息中收到物料凭证编号。

Reservation of Inventory by using MB1A

假设我们想取消我们的预留。

当然,可以使用 MIGO 事务来完成,但让我们来了解另一个事务。

使用 MBST 预留库存

步骤 1)

  1. 执行 **MBST** 事务代码。
  2. 输入上一步创建的凭证编号。按 **ENTER**。

Reservation of Inventory by using MBST

**步骤 2)** 您可以看到,为此目的系统使用了移动类型 **202** – 成本中心的反向冲销。

这是因为我们在 OMJJ 事务中将其定义为 Mvt.type 201 的反向冲销移动类型。

保存事务数据,您的先前凭证将被冲销。

Reservation of Inventory by using MBST

现在您可以使用 t-code **MB22** 再次为同一预留创建物料凭证,或**取消预留本身**。

使用 MB22 预留库存

步骤 1)

  1. 执行事务。
  2. 输入预留编号。按 **ENTER**。

Reservation of Inventory by using MB22

**步骤 2)** 勾选框以标记预留已完成(这意味着不再期望该预留有货物过账)。

Reservation of Inventory by using MB22

您已成功取消了预留的进一步处理。